Do you, or someone you know, have a child 3 to 4 years old who is learning to speak English as an additional language?

Success Library runs special storytimes four times a year for children who do not speak English at home, or who speak limited English.

Talk, sing, read, write, & play every day

Learning English Through Storytime (LETS) is a special storytime that runs for ten weeks and gives children a chance to practise English through songs, rhymes and conversation, to improve their skills and confidence.

Each LETS session will involve reading, interactive activities, and craft. It’s a great place to practise English ready for school.

Program details

Ages: 3-4 years old
Bookings required: Yes
Cost: Free
Locations, days & times:

  • Success Library – Mondays – 11.30am-12.30pm (Except school holidays)

LETS runs in ten week blocks, each school term , covering a range of everyday topics with a focus on literacy and numeracy. Places are strictly limited, so book early.
